How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Oxford?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Oxford Studio Apartments | $2,141 | $1,174 | $2,585 |
| Oxford 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,291 | $1,326 | $3,577 |
| Oxford 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,403 | $1,516 | $3,734 |
| Oxford 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,402 | $1,400 | $3,617 |
| Oxford 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,265 | $2,836 | $3,695 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Oxford
How much are Studio apartments in Oxford?
There are currently 20 Studio Apartments in Oxford with rent ranges from $1,174 to $2,585 with an average price of $2,141.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Oxford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Oxford ranges from $1,326 to $3,577 with an average monthly rent of $2,291.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Oxford c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Oxford range from $1,516 to $3,734.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,403.
